"it is going to be a high quality FPS"
if you are realy heading for professional quality, you have to live with harsh critics. let's start.

screenshot2: the menu looks awful. the color, the font, the faked glow... it all looks pretty bad, it simply doesn't fit at all. looks like if you just got Photoshop somewhere and tried out a text effect, nothing more.

screenshot3: the HUD is a joke, isn't it?
The lighting situation is bad. geometry is uninteresting, all buildings have the same height, texture. the cable on top is unrealistic in texture, size, shape, connectors. don't use standard.wad at all. what a blocky and high pavement!

screenshot4: the gun texture looks awful, just if it had just a 2side mapping (stetched around corners etc.) the hand looks even worse in texturing and shape. im' not going to talk about the "graffitti". looking for a good fire effect? check easyparticles from hawkgames.com. the bin texture doesn't fit and the lighting on them isn't correct (seams).

screenshot5: cables have been discussed already. too foggy, as if the engine could't handle hte geo. if you're looking for a foggy image, you have to use 3dgs fog in combination with a sprite system (local fog).

screenshot6: lamp lighing is incorrect. _never_ use the standard text output (what's formerly been msg_show).

screenshot7: blurry, undetailed, upscaled textures, combined with bad models and wrong lighting. pixel-blood. a CSG "step" in the right pathway.

hope that's enough for today. don't take it too personaly, but if you're heading for professional art, you have a looong way yet to go. you won't learn anything from a "nice game"-comment.
